Hi there. One question has been nagging at me, and I'm hoping that some of the more sage and connected members of this board might be able to help me out. I have a zilla/goldfroggy descendent out of Chris Allen's stock, and I have seen the lineage pop up quite a bit in the classifieds. I'm assuming that these are foundation stock animals, but I really don't know anything about them. Is there anybody here who can fill in the blanks for me about the identity of the mythic Zilla and Goldfroggy? If there are any pics around, I would love to see those too. Thanks so much in advance.

Give me a few minutes and I will dig in my old computer for this info and the photos of the original Godzilla and Goldfroggy.

Godzilla was a wonderful male that was actually a rescue, a dull color. Once he got good care, diet, temps and UVB, he shed into the most lovely golds. Personally I think he resembles many of the dragons from Kevin Dunne of Dragon's Den Herp's earlier Sunburst line dragons. He also grew to a remarkable good size which is more common in Kevin's lines than many other breeders of the golds, or sunburst.

Godzilla is very hearty, despite his early on care, just good genetics there. Godzilla is still alive, but an old man and is doing educational programs in California.

Goldfroggy was the female of the line, another beautiful dragon with high golds and some orange, she had prominent eye sockets, hence the name Goldfroggy.

Many of the larger size, colorful dragons around today, came from this line, breed into other lines like the Flame one or JoelR's line.

He was only breed for a few years and as far as I remember only two females, Goldfroggy and a pastel female.
